MGMT 101 - Introduction to E-Commerce



5.0 Credits
Covers the key business and technology elements of electronic commerce. Students learn about revenue models, marketing, business-to-business strategies and virtual communities and social networks. Course also introduces basic Web server hardware and software as well as electronic commerce software, security and payment systems. Prerequisite

Course-level Learning Objectives (CLOs)
Upon successful completion of this course, students will be able to:

  1. Identify and explain the key features of the Internet.
  2. Describe and analyze how the Internet is used to market, sell, and distribute goods and services.
  3. Analyze various websites, including their structure and design.
  4. Analyze and examine security programs to protect business and clients.
  5. Develop criteria for establishing an effective business presence on the Web.
  6. Examine the legal, global, and ethical issues confronting electronic commerce.
